Transaction 51d2fd7528811226bf5c690de88f38036ecbc65fec17598ef00fd45440d35f55
1 Input
1 Output
-
51d2fd7528811226bf5c690de88f38036ecbc65fec17598ef00fd45440d35f55:0
- value
- 489674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2c91d3d35a0c371a7128371dbace856d266775a OP_EQUAL
- address
- 3NN9ZZKdKZPxTH4eK1C5fszEsszq8erY9W